When comparing trading costs for Pakistan traders, FxPro generally offers lower spreads on major forex pairs like EUR/USD and GBP/USD, with tight raw spreads from 0.0 pips plus a commission on its cTrader and MT5 platforms. Forex.com's standard account spreads start around 1.0 pips on majors, which is higher but includes no commission. For high-volume traders in Pakistan, FxPro's raw spread model can significantly reduce costs, especially when trading multiple lots daily. Forex.com does provide competitive pricing on its commission-based Razor account, but spreads are still slightly wider than FxPro's on average. Swap fees are also important; both brokers offer Islamic accounts that eliminate overnight swaps, but FxPro's policy is more favorable for long-term holds. Overall, FxPro wins on cost efficiency for Pakistani retail traders.

Both brokers offer the industry-standard M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5), which are widely used by Pakistan traders due to their robust charting, automated trading via Expert Advisors, and mobile trading capabilities. FxPro also provides its proprietary FxPro Edge platform and cTrader, which offers advanced order types and a cleaner interface for scalping. Forex.com's proprietary platform is a web-based solution with integrated research tools, but it is less popular among local traders. For Pakistan users who trade on mobile via smartphones, both brokers have reliable apps with real-time quotes and one-click trading. FxPro's additional platform choices give it an edge for traders seeking more flexibility.

FxPro uses a No Dealing Desk (NDD) model with direct market access, offering low latency and minimal slippage on most trades. Forex.com operates as a market maker with STP execution for certain account types. For Pakistan traders, especially scalpers and high-frequency traders, FxPro's execution is generally faster with better fill quality. Forex.com's execution is still reliable for standard trading, but occasional re-quotes can occur during volatile news events. FxPro also offers negative balance protection and partial fills on limit orders, enhancing execution reliability.

Forex.com is regulated in multiple jurisdictions including the FCA (UK), CFTC/NFA (US), and others, while FxPro holds licenses from the FCA, CySEC, FSCA, and SCB. For Pakistan traders, these regulations mean that funds are held in segregated accounts and negative balance protection is offered (except under CySEC). Neither broker is regulated by the SECP, but the absence of local oversight is common for international brokers serving Pakistan. FxPro's multiple-tier regulation (especially FCA) provides stronger investor protection compared to Forex.com's US-based regulation, which limits leverage for non-US clients to 1:50. In practice, FxPro's regulatory framework is more favorable for Pakistan traders seeking high leverage and flexible conditions.

Pakistan traders can fund their accounts using local methods at both brokers. Forex.com accepts bank wire transfers and, through third-party processors, supports USDT TRC20 and limited local wallets. FxPro directly integrates JazzCash, Easypaisa, USDT TRC20, and bank transfers via its payment partners, making deposits faster and more convenient. Deposits via JazzCash and Easypaisa are typically instant with low fees, while USDT TRC20 deposits are processed within minutes. Bank transfers may take 1-3 business days. Withdrawals are equally straightforward: both brokers process requests within 24 hours, but FxPro offers faster turnaround for e-wallets and USDT. Forex.com's withdrawal fees can be higher for bank transfers. For Pakistani traders, FxPro's wider range of local deposit options and lower fees make it the more practical choice.

Both Forex.com and FxPro off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ts compliant with Sharia law for Pakistani Muslim traders. FxPro's Islamic account is available on all account types and platforms, with no restrictions on trading styles, holding periods, or the number of open positions. Forex.com also provides a swap-free option, but it applies conditions such as no trades held over the weekend and potential administrative fees after a certain period. For long-term traders in Pakistan who need to hold positions for weeks, FxPro's policy is more flexible. Both require a declaration of religious belief, and the accounts are permanent once activated. Overall, FxPro offers the better Islamic account solution for Pakistan traders.
